Product Features by Maturity
This page is intended as a reference of features by maturity level; each item will link you to our documentation, and you can also see what level of maturity each feature is currently at. You may also be interested in seeing our feature compatibility matrix and availability by deployment options.
Maturity definitions
- Generally Available โ : Available as a normal product feature.
- Partially Available ๐ฃ: Available, but may be limited in some significant ways.
- Beta โจ: Available in pre-release form on a limited basis.
- Experimental ๐ฌ: Available in pre-release form, with significant caveats.
- Not Implemented ๐ฎ: This is something we may do, but it is not yet available.
- Deprecated โ ๏ธ: This is a feature that we plan to remove.
Feature maturity levels
Search Product
Product Manager: Loรฏc Guychard
Feature | Maturity |
---|---|
Literal Search | Generally Available โ |
Regular Expression Search | Generally Available โ |
Structural Search | Generally Available โ |
Diff/Commit Search | Generally Available โ |
Code Monitoring | Generally Available โ |
Code Monitoring E-mail Notifications | Generally Available โ |
Code Monitoring Webhooks | Not Implemented ๐ฎ |
Saved Searches | Generally Available โ |
Search Contexts | Generally Available โ |
Code Intelligence
Product Manager: Marรญa Craig
Feature | Maturity |
---|---|
Search-based code navigation | Generally Available โ |
Precise code navigation for Go | Generally Available โ |
Precise code navigation for JavaScript/TypeScript | Partially Available ๐ฃ |
Precise code navigation for Java, Scala & Kotlin | Generally Available โ |
Precise code navigation for C/C++ | Partially Available ๐ฃ |
Precise code navigation for Python | Generally Available โ |
Precise code navigation for C# | Not Implemented ๐ฎ |
Precise code navigation for Ruby | Generally Available โ |
Precise code navigation for Rust | Generally Available โ |
Precise code navigation auto-indexing | Partially Available ๐ฃ |
Executors | Partially Available ๐ฃ |
Notes:
- Auto-indexing for self-hosted requires self-hosting executors.
Batch Changes
Product Manager: Malo Marrec
Feature | Maturity |
---|---|
Batch Changes | Generally Available โ |
Server-side batch changes | Beta โจ |
Code Insights
Product Manager: Joel Kwartler
Feature | Maturity |
---|---|
Code Insights | Generally Available โ |
Code Exploration
Feature | Maturity |
---|---|
Browser Extension | Generally Available โ |
Pre-built Extensions | Generally Available โ |
Custom Extensions | Generally Available โ |
Identity and Access Management (IAM)
Identity and Access Management (IAM) Strategy
Product Manager: Ryan Phillips
Feature | Maturity |
---|---|
User Authentication | Generally Available โ |
Delivery
Product Manager: Beyang Liu
Feature | Maturity |
---|---|
Single Container Deployment | Generally Available โ |
Docker Compose Deployment | Generally Available โ |
Kubernetes Deployment | Generally Available โ |
Repo Management
Product Manager: Ryan Phillips
Feature | Maturity |
---|---|
Repository Syncing | Generally Available โ |
Repository Permissions | Generally Available โ |
Native Integration | Generally Available โ |
Security
Feature | Maturity |
---|---|
SOC II Type II | Not Implemented ๐ฎ |